Building and Preserving Your Collection
- Record each series name, release year, and distribution region in a simple log.
- Photograph every figure with its packaging for provenance and insurance purposes.
- Handle pieces with clean hands or soft tools to avoid paint scratches.
- Use climate controlled storage and UV protective cases to preserve color and details over time.
- Join collector communities to trade duplicates and stay updated on upcoming drops.

Why do some Mini McDonald's toys sell for much higher than the original meal price?
Scarcity, condition, licensed branding, and collector demand drive premiums on the secondary market, especially for retired or chase items.
Can I request a specific Mini toy at my local McDonald's location?
Most McDonald's locations cannot guarantee specific figures, as distribution follows regional and promotional plans determined by corporate teams.
Are Mini toys safe for young children and how should I clean them?
Manufactured to strict safety standards, the figures can be cleaned gently with a damp cloth and mild soap, avoiding harsh chemicals that might damage paint.
How can I verify if my Mini McDonald's toy is a rare variant or error piece?
Cross reference production codes, color details, and known variant lists on collector forums and official brand announcements to confirm rarity.
